Executive Director, Karlos Community Development and Empowerment Initiative, Comrade Abdulsalam Sani Dabban, hails the appointment of Dr. Abubakar Adamu as the Executive Secretary of the Agricultural Research Council of Nigeria (ARCN).
Abubaker was recently appointed by Federal Government under the leadership of President Bola Ahmed Tinubu to head the Council.
Dabban described the appointment as a strategic and timely development that will greatly enhance agricultural research and innovation in Nigeria.
He spoke during the presentation of start-up packs 100 women and youths in Lavun local government area of Niger State.
He also expressed appreciation to President Bola Ahmed Tinubu for appointing “one of the finest minds capable of driving an agricultural research revolution in the country.”
He highlighted the organization’s ongoing commitment to grassroots economic empowerment and sustainable development.
“We believe Dr. Abubakar Adamu’s leadership at ARCN will deliver transformative solutions to the challenges facing agricultural development, particularly in the areas of innovation, research commercialization, and youth engagement,” Comrade Dabban stated.
He reiterated that Karlos Community Development and Empowerment Initiative remains focused on poverty reduction, youth and women empowerment, and rural development through practical and scalable interventions that foster self-reliance and inclusive growth.
Comrade Dabban expressed optimism that collaboration between government institutions and civil society will deepen under Dr. Adamu’s tenure, ensuring that research outcomes are translated into tangible improvements for farmers and rural communities.
